What is China General Education Group Return-on-Tangible-Equity?

China General Education Group HKSE:02175 -10.77% 80 Return-on-Tangible-Equity is 5.70% as of Feb. 2026, which is 43% below its 10-year median of 9.99. GuruFocus rates HKSE:02175 with a GF Score™ of 80/100 and a GF Value™ of HK$3.20 (Modestly Undervalued). The stock has 4 warning signs investors should review. Among 247 Education companies, China General Education Group ranks worse than 65.99% on this metric.

Return-on-Tangible-Equity is calculated as Net Income divided by its average total shareholder tangible equity. Total shareholder tangible equity equals to Total Stockholders Equity minus Intangible Assets. China General Education Group's annualized net income for the quarter that ended in Feb. 2026 was HK$115.3 Mil. China General Education Group's average shareholder tangible equity for the quarter that ended in Feb. 2026 was HK$2,022.1 Mil. Therefore, China General Education Group's annualized Return-on-Tangible-Equity for the quarter that ended in Feb. 2026 was 5.70%.

China General Education Group  (HKSE:02175) Return-on-Tangible-Equity Explanation

Return-on-Tangible-Equity measures the rate of return on the ownership interest (shareholder's tangible equity) of the common stock owners. It measures a firm's efficiency at generating profits from every unit of shareholders' tangible equity (shareholders equity minus intangibles). Return-on-Tangible-Equity shows how well a company uses investment funds to generate earnings growth. Return-on-Tangible-Equitys between 15% and 20% are considered desirable.


Be Aware

Net Income is used.

Because a company can increase its Return-on-Tangible-Equity by having more financial leverage, it is important to watch the leverage ratio when investing in high Return-on-Tangible-Equity companies. Like Return-on-Tangible-Asset, Return-on-Tangible-Equity is calculated with only 12 months data. Fluctuations in company's earnings or business cycles can affect the ratio drastically. It is important to look at the ratio from a long term perspective.

Asset light businesses require very few assets to generate very high earnings. Their Return-on-Tangible-Equitys can be extremely high.

China General Education Group Business Description

Address No. 99 Wucheng South Road, Xiaodian District, Shanxi Province, Taiyuan, CHN
China General Education Group Ltd is principally engaged in the provision of higher education services. The company operates one college, Shanxi Technology and Business College, in which it offers bachelor's degree programs in a total of around 39 majors including three concentrations to undergraduate students including accounting, auditing, civil engineering, and business administration. The Company also focuses on providing applied courses and internship training opportunities. The Group generates maximum revenue from Mainland China.
